Commission Rate & Model
The Cop Slots affiliate program, operated through Super Partners, primarily uses a Revenue Share commission model. Public Super Partners affiliate information commonly shows a tiered structure ranging from 25% to 40% Revenue Share, with higher commission levels typically unlocked as affiliates generate greater numbers of first-time depositing players.
This structure is particularly attractive for casino-focused affiliates because referred players can continue generating revenue over an extended period through slots, jackpots, and casino games. The highest 40% Revenue Share tier is competitive within the online casino affiliate industry, although it is generally performance-based and not automatically available to every new affiliate.
Affiliates earn a percentage of the Net Gaming Revenue generated by players referred to Cop Slots.
This creates recurring earning potential from players who continue using slots, jackpots, casino games, and other gaming products.
Public Super Partners information commonly lists 25% for 0β10 FTDs, 30% for 11β40 FTDs, 35% for 41β100 FTDs, and 40% for 101+ FTDs.
The commission model rewards growth and consistent player acquisition, allowing larger affiliates to unlock substantially higher earnings percentages.
CPA agreements may be available for affiliates capable of delivering qualified depositing players through approved acquisition channels.
CPA deals can provide faster cash flow and may appeal to affiliates focused on short-term player acquisition rather than recurring Revenue Share.
Hybrid deals combine a fixed CPA payment with ongoing Revenue Share from referred players.
This structure can provide both immediate acquisition revenue and long-term recurring earnings from active players.
Super Partners commonly offers a 2% sub-affiliate commission on the earnings generated by referred affiliate partners.
This creates an additional passive income opportunity for affiliate networks, agencies, and experienced gambling publishers.

If your referred Cop Slots players generate Β£5,000 in Net Gaming Revenue and your Revenue Share rate is 40%, your commission would be approximately Β£2,000. At the entry-level 25% tier, the same revenue would generate approximately Β£1,250.
Cookie Duration
The Cop Slots affiliate program, operated through Super Partners, generally uses a 30-day tracking cookie together with a last-click attribution model. When a visitor clicks an approved affiliate link, the referral can normally remain tracked for up to 30 days, provided the cookie remains active and the player registers within the tracking window.
This setup works well for casino and slots affiliates because players often spend time comparing bonuses, free spins offers, game libraries, payment methods, and casino reviews before opening an account. However, because attribution is typically based on the latest qualifying affiliate referral, the final affiliate interaction normally receives commission credit.
Visitors who click a Cop Slots affiliate link can generally remain attributed for up to 30 days before registration, assuming the cookie remains active.
This gives potential players time to compare casino brands, bonuses, free spins offers, and reviews before deciding to register.
Under a last-click attribution model, the most recent qualifying affiliate referral normally receives credit for the player registration.
Earlier referrals may lose attribution if the visitor clicks another affiliate link before registering with Cop Slots.
Affiliate links contain unique tracking parameters that identify the referring affiliate when a player creates an account and becomes a qualified customer.
Correct link implementation is essential to ensure registrations, deposits, and player activity are accurately credited.
Super Partners does not publicly provide detailed information regarding cross-device attribution for Cop Slots.
Affiliates should generally assume standard cookie-based tracking unless alternative attribution methods are confirmed by their affiliate manager.
Affiliates should regularly test tracking links, redirects, landing pages, and geo-targeting settings to ensure referrals are recorded correctly.
Broken links, cookie deletion, ad blockers, missing affiliate IDs, or redirect errors can result in lost commission attribution.
Casino players often spend time researching bonuses, game libraries, payment methods, mobile compatibility, and casino reviews before making a deposit.
The 30-day cookie helps affiliates capture delayed conversions that are common within the online casino sector.

Payouts
The Cop Slots affiliate program uses the Super Partners payment framework. Public Super Partners information commonly lists Bank Transfer, PayPal, Skrill, Neteller, and EcoPayz as available affiliate payout methods. The standard minimum payout is typically β¬100 for e-wallet payments, while Bank Transfer generally requires a higher minimum balance of β¬700.
This payout setup is practical for casino affiliates who use e-wallets, because PayPal, Skrill, Neteller, and EcoPayz allow access to commissions at a lower threshold than bank transfer. The main drawback is the high bank-transfer minimum, which can delay payments for smaller affiliates. Payments are generally processed on a monthly cycle, with unpaid balances rolling forward until the relevant threshold is met.
